Stand By Me is one of the most beautiful movies I've ever seen. Going into this movie I knew I was gonna like it as soon as I met Gordy, Chris, Teddy, and Verne. The cast of this film had some of the best chemistry I've seen between any characters.
They made me laugh, think, and cry. Stand By Me is based off the Stephen King novel "The Body" and it's about 4 kids set out to find the body of Ray Baur (think that's how it's spelled) and end up creating a stronger bond together than ever.
This adventure was really heartwarming and realistic. The dialogue is how a preteen would talk when they're alone with friends and the way they act is very kiddish too. The characters were super likable and funny I can't even stress it enough.
The struggles they encounter are fun to watch especially the scene when they think they're in the presence of coyotes. The realistic factor this has about growing up and how friends come and go is very heartwarming and tearjerking.
All the kids had a tragic background that haunted them especially Gordy who thinks his parents loathe him after the lost of his beloved brother Denny. Stand By Me is a masterpiece. The characters were great, the story was heartwarming and touching, the affect this movie left me with just stays.
Love this film. A.
